U.S. fire departments respond to approximately 13,820 home fires each year caused by clothes dryers.
Failure to clean the dryer vent system is the leading cause.
These fires result in hundreds of injuries, millions in property damage, and preventable insurance claims annually.

Most homes should have dryer vents cleaned at least once per year. If you do lots of laundry, have pets, or a long vent run, you may need cleaning every 6–9 months.
Common signs include clothes taking longer to dry, a hot dryer, burning smell, lint around the dryer, or the outside vent flap not opening properly.
Most dryer vent cleanings take 30–90 minutes depending on vent length, access, and the amount of lint buildup in the line.
